Etching and aquatint, hand signed by the artist. // Argi IV by Eduardo Chillida, created in 1988, is an etching and aquatint that emphasizes simplicity and the play of light and shadow through abstract forms. The artwork features an arrangement of black geometric shapes that interrupt the white space, creating a balanced yet fragmented composition. These dark, rectangular forms are placed across the image with subtle irregularities and gaps, evoking architectural structures or a stylized landscape. Chillida’s mastery of negative space draws the viewer’s attention to both the forms themselves and the blank areas, inviting contemplation on presence and absence. Argi, meaning light in Basque, is reflected in the piece’s exploration of contrast, simplicity, and the interaction between form and void.

What is Art Informel?
Art Informel is a French term referring to the gestural and improvisational techniques common in abstract painting during the 1940s and 50s. It encompasses various styles that dominated these decades, characterized by informal, spontaneous methods. Artists used this term to describe approaches that moved away from traditional structures and embraced more expressive, unstructured techniques.
